What Is an ICP, Really?
An ICP is not just a slide in your go-to-market deck. It’s a strategic profile of the types of companies or buyers who are most likely to benefit from and purchase your product. Think:
- Company size and industry
- Job titles and decision-makers
- Pain points, motivations, and buying triggers
- Tech stack, budget cycles, or growth stage
When used well, your ICP becomes a guiding lens for targeting, messaging, and prioritization. It helps filter out noise and align teams on who matters most.

Why Generic AI Doesn’t Work in Sales
AI tools are powerful, but without the right inputs, they fall flat. Here’s what happens when you skip the ICP:
- Tone-deaf emails that don’t match the buyer’s world
- Wrong value props for the wrong persona
- Low engagement rates despite automation scale
Let’s look at a simple example:
Prompt A: “Write a follow-up email for a product demo.”
Prompt B: “Write a follow-up email for a Head of Operations at a logistics startup who saw a demo of our automated inventory tracking tool.”
Same task. Radically different results. One is generic. The other is grounded in ICP.

How to Inject ICP into Prompts and Workflows
The fix is simple and powerful: teach your AI who it's talking to.
Here are ways to do that:
- Prompt with precision
- Instead of: "Write a cold email."
- Try: "Write a cold email to a VP of Finance at a 200-person SaaS company struggling with manual forecasting."
- Include buyer language and pain points
- Add: industry-specific terms, common objections, and emotional motivators.
- Example: Instead of "boost efficiency," say "reduce reconciliation time by 30%."
- Create reusable prompt templates
- Build modular prompts like:
- [Job Title] at [Company Size] in [Industry] dealing with [Pain Point]...
- This keeps messaging scalable yet tailored.
- Use retrieval or knowledge-enhanced agents
- For advanced use, bring in ICP docs, win-loss analysis, or deal notes.
- Let your AI reference these in real time to improve outputs.
- Use scorecards to validate relevance
- Before you deploy prompts at scale, score AI responses against your ICP. Are the pain points right? Is the tone aligned?
Real-World Scenarios
Here are a few areas where aligning AI with ICP delivers huge wins:
- Outbound Email: Personalized hooks that speak to industry challenges and role-specific pain.
- Call Prep: Talking points that show you understand the buyer's world, not just the product.
- Objection Handling: AI-generated rebuttals that reflect the buyer's lens—not boilerplate text.
- Deal Prioritization: Use AI to flag high-fit accounts based on ICP traits, not just engagement metrics.
- Sales Enablement Content: AI can generate playbooks, competitive talk tracks, and battle cards when it understands the audience.
